The Optometrist role is a licensed optometrist with a special interest and expertise in Refractive Surgery, Cataract Surgery, and Dry Eye. The Optometrist will be trained in all aspects of refractive surgical patient pre- and post-operative management. Clinical duties include but are not limited to eye exams, diagnostic testing, refractions, and counseling necessary pre and post refractive surgery to achieve exceptional outcomes. Duties also include general eye care including eye exams, contact lens fitting, and management of ocular disease.
